Can we DELETE all the Generations of a GDG at once, WITHOUT
deleting the GDG itself ?
Answers were Sorted based on User's Feedback
Answer / kalone
Yes , we can do that by using following step :
//step1 dd pgm=iefbr14
//gdggen dd dsn=base-gdg-file,DISP=(MOD,DELETE,DELETE)
The above code will delete all the generations except the
base GDG.TO delete base GDG you need to use IDCAMS.
| Is This Answer Correct ? | 20 Yes | 3 No |
Answer / kranthi kumar m
yes,we can,by pressing d infront of command prompt before
all generations but we can't delete gdg base directly, if we
want delete base use syntax like dis,
//sysin dd *
delete (base-name) purge
/*
//
| Is This Answer Correct ? | 9 Yes | 5 No |
Answer / deepak narasappa
During such scenario..always create dummy GDG version at
the end of job.. SO whenever your job runs, atleast one
dummy file will be present and also you can avoid abend..
| Is This Answer Correct ? | 3 Yes | 1 No |
Answer / dedicated_programmer
Thanks Kranthi,
And Using Purge or Force will delete the GDG Base as well as
all the generations of the GDG. While Using Delete without
any option DELETS only the INDEX of the GDG.
Could you please help in sorting out whether there is a way
to DELETE ONLY ALL THE GENERATIONS OF THE GDG WITHOUT
DELETING THE BASE, "USING JCL".
| Is This Answer Correct ? | 2 Yes | 1 No |
Answer / dedicated_programmer
Thanks for completing the answer, Kalone.
| Is This Answer Correct ? | 4 Yes | 3 No |
Answer / bobie kamahuha bobzy
Do the following;
//p gxxxxxx
gxxxxxx
gxxxxxx
gxxxxxx
gxxxxxx
gxxxxxx
// gxxxxxx
Make sure the *//* are properly arrigned
| Is This Answer Correct ? | 1 Yes | 1 No |
Answer / sam
I am facing problems while deleting all GDG versions except
base using IEFBR14. My job fails when I try to execute
IEFBR14 with my GDG base having no versions, causing
problems in my job flow.
I want to delete all gdg versions if they exist otherwsie
my job should execute fine.
Can anyone suggest solution for this?
| Is This Answer Correct ? | 2 Yes | 3 No |
Why block size is multiple of lrecl in jcl?
I have four steps in jcl they are STEP1,STEP2,STEP3 and STEP4. Can it possible to run the reverse order like step4 first then step3,step2,step1?
What is the job entry system used in your project? based on what criteria the sequence of jobs are picked if priority is not mentioned in the job card?
i have a jcl calling proc which has 10 steps, i want to execute from step5 to step10, where can i code RESTART and COND parameter?
When cursor is not closed what is the error?
Could you provide an example and its effect OF, Using COND on JOB and EXEC both ?
Whats error code s222?
State the uses of syspring, sysin, sort fields, sum fields and dummy.
a jcl has 2 steps. How to code the jcl such that if step1 abends, then step2 runs. Else, job terminates with step1?
A statement about PROCs is " In PROCs, Symbolic Parameters can be assigned on PROC and EXEC", BUT On which EXEC, (i) On the JCL's EXEC which is calling to PROC1. (Inside JCL, EXEC PROC1) (ii) or On the PROC's EXEC where it calls the PGM1. (Inside PROC, EXEC PGM=PGM1)
I had Records in file Like this Company Code IBM 2 IBM 1 IBM 4 WIPRO 3 WIPRO 2 WIPRO 9 TCS 4 TCS 6 TCS 3 i want the record of every company with highest code How can i do that?
what is the function of iebcompr?....is it compare record length or characteristics of a dataset?...pls explain with examples.......